The fifth sassy and irresistible entry in the Debutante Dropout series finds Andy Kendricks uncovering more than just the beauty secrets of Dallas high society.

They call them pretty parties, and they're the latest rage among Dallas debutantes - get-togethers with light refreshments, heavy gossip, and Dr. Sonja and her magic Botox needles. Former socialite Andy Kendricks normally wouldn't be caught dead at such an event, but she's attending as a favor to her friend, Janet, a society reporter in search of a juicy story. And boy does she find one when aging beauty queen Miranda DuBois bursts into the room - drunk, disorderly, and packing a pistol.

Miranda's wrinkles have seen better days, and she blames it all on Dr. Sonja. Luckily, Andy calms her down and gets her home...where she's found dead the next morning. The police suspect suicide, but Andy knows that no former pageant girl would give up that easily. She's determined to find Miranda's killer herself, but she'll have to be careful. After all, Botox can make you look younger, but it can't bring you back from the grave.

11 of 13 people found the following review helpful. This is not one to miss! By Detra Fitch The latest rage among all the Dallas debutantes is called a Pretty Party. Doctor Sonja Madhavi and Lance Zarimba, her boyfriend/aesthetician, show up with their "Botox in the Box" kit full of syringes and give little samples to each party guest. Few attend these parties and never show up at the Pretty Place boutique for treatments afterward. Former socialite Andrea "Andy" Kendricks would rather have a root canal than attend one, but attend she did. It was a favor to her close friend Janet Graham, a society reporter for the Park City Paper (PCP). And the juiciest story in the area drops into Janet's lap when aging beauty queen Miranda DuBois slams into the room full of alcohol, rage, and a small gun. Miranda is a star anchorwoman and went to the good doctor for just a tad of face work. Unfortunately, Miranda had "an adverse reaction to the wrinkle filler". Luckily the only thing hit by the bullet is a Picasso. Andy calms Miranda down and takes her home to bed. The next morning Miranda is found dead.The last thing Andy wants is to be dragged into another gut-wrenching drama. However, Miranda's mother is out of the country and the police think the death is by suicide. So Cissy Blevins Kendricks, Queen Bee of Dallas Society (a.k.a. Andy's mother), is named trustee of all Miranda's possessions. Add to this that Miranda's mother insists Cissy hire someone to conduct an independent autopsy (to draw his own conclusions separate and apart from the M.E.) as well as a private investigator. To make matters go from bad to worse, Cissy and the deputy have an argument, which everyone hears because the microphone was still on by mistake, so everyone knows that Andy was the last known person to see Miranda alive AND hears Cissy's claim (a.k.a. lie) that Andy has proof it was not suicide! Here we go again ...***** This is one fun and sassy read. Only Susan McBride can create such an amusing mystery that simply overflows with ... ah, tea and vinegar. The Debutante Dropout Mystery Series just seems to get better and better. This is not one to miss! *****Reviewed by Detra Fitch of Huntress Reviews.

Beth Camdenʼs divorce doesnʼt spare her from becoming a subject in her ex-husbandʼs money-laundering scheme with a Florida mobster. When two million dollars of evidence money her ex owes the mobster vanishes, the Fedʼs case starts to crumble.Disregarding panic attacks and the threat of a hurricane, Beth flees her beach house. Sheʼs determined to find the money, prove her innocence, and clear her name. Instead, she finds herself a suspect in a brutal murder when her name is scrawled in blood at the murder scene. Her ex schemes to pay back the mobster with life insurance he holds on Beth. The mobster has his own evil plan to secure the money and eliminate Beth as a witness. 
The Feds hire the former deputy marshall Rafe Morgan to protect her. Morgan accepts the job with his own motives, to avenge the hit man and mobster. And the Camden name is a reminder of guilt he suffers when he couldnʼt save a witness from death. In their personal search for justice, they donʼt count on the passion that erupts between them. The weekend sizzles with deception, danger and seduction.

Benjamin An has discovered the human hand structure, which explains why humans are born to hit with an implement and to throw with a trajectory release. Hitting and throwing became the most powerful actions in the animal kingdom. These actions became the primary tools for humans to survive historically. Survival skills become sports actions in the modern, civilized world. Different sports were invented with modification of the sports actions. Dr. An has looked into these actions seriously in terms of human nature-intellectually, biomechanically, psychologically, physically, and mentally-in order to help athletes perform these actions without confusion. Many performance problems occur just because these actions are parts of human nature and humans know too much about these actions. For example, for every action, a human knows the results of this action. It is very hard for a human to concentrate on the actions only and ignore the results of these actions. Thinking about the results has become one of the most serious interferences of that action itself. Dr. An calls these intellectual interferences. Human physical actions are complicated by human mental thoughts and intellectual understandings. Sports actions are not just physical actions. Sports actions have to be modified if it is necessary and executed with specific mental thoughts in order to fit in any specific sport. The author has specifically emphasized on these points in his book.

About the Author Benjamin An was born in Henan, China, in 1931. He was one of those so-called refugee students who traveled through the battlefield during the Civil War period. He finally went to Taiwan with one of his elder brothers who was in the service of the Chinese Air Force at that time. He got his BS degree in biochemistry from Chung Hsing University, Taiwan, in 1958. After graduation, he taught at the Chinese Military Academy for two years before he came to the United States to pursue his graduate studies. He came to the United States in 1961 and entered the University of California at Berkeley, majoring in nuclear chemistry. After obtaining his MS degree at Berkeley, he went to teach at Cleveland State University for three years in the department of chemistry. He went to the University of Michigan under the tutorship of Dr. J. L. Oncley to study the lipoproteins in the department of biophysics and become a PhD candidate. After the decease of Dr. Oncley, he proceeded to the University of Detroit and got his dental degree as a DDS in 1966.

How do you build a champion? For the Golden State Warriors, it started with a vision.

That vision was of a team that Head Coach Steve Kerr described as having the magic that occurs when a group of players, coaches, and an organization come together and achieve something special. After 40 years of waiting, Golden State Warrior fans have witnessed that magic.

STRENGTH IN NUMBERS is the Golden State Warriors official team commemorative, celebrating the historic games, plays, and personalities that brought an NBA championship back to the Bay Area. This is the story of how the Warriors came together to realize their potential, becoming a powder keg on offense and unleashing synchronized chaos on defense. The Warriors unique blend of efficiency on both ends of the floor resulted in a franchise-record 67-win season, a 16-game winning streak, and a 39-2 home record powered by the most electric crowd in basketball.

The best sports photographers in the business provide the definitive perspective on this record-setting season, chronicling such landmark events as the team s 26-point comeback win over the Boston Celtics, Klay Thompson s NBA-record 37 points in a single quarter, Stephen Curry s miracle 3-pointer to force overtime against the Pelicans in Game 3 of the Conference Quarterfinals, the team s relentless defensive stand against LeBron James one-man wrecking crew in the Finals, and the celebration of Warrior fans around the world as the final buzzer sounded and returned the Larry O Brien Trophy to the Bay Area.

With original contributions by team and media insiders, STRENGTH IN NUMBERS is a tribute to the sacrifice, determination, and, most importantly, teamwork that defined the magical NBA Champion Golden State Warriors.

Kara Tippetts's story was not a story of disease, although she lost her battle with terminal cancer. It was not a story of saying goodbye, although she was intentional in her time with her husband and four children. Kara's story was one of seeing God in the hard and in the good. It was one of finding grace in the everyday. And it was one of knowing "God with us" through fierce and beautiful friendship. In Just Show Up, Kara and her close friend, Jill Lynn Buteyn, write about what friendship looks like in the midst of changing life seasons, loads of laundry, and even cancer. Whether you are eager to be present to someone going through a difficult time or simply want inspiration for pursuing friends in a new way, this eloquent and practical book explores the gift of silence, the art of receiving, and what it means to just show up.The late Kara Tippetts was the author of The Hardest Peace and blogged faithfully at mundanefaithfulness.com. Cancer was only a part of Kara's story. Her real fight was to truly live while facing a crushing reality. Since her death in March 2015, her husband, Jason, is parenting their four children and leading the church they founded in Colorado Springs, Colorado. Jill Lynn Buteyn lives in Colorado with her husband and two children. She has a bachelor's degree in communications from Bethel University. In 2013, she won the ACFW Genesis award for her inspirational novel, Falling for Texas (written as Jill Lynn).

The 2005 Charleston Southern University football team was poised for their best season in school history. The Buccaneers earned a school-best 5-5 record in their preceding season. It was the first time the program had achieved a non-losing status. At feat with which everyone on campus was satisfied. Everyone, that is, except the team. A gap no less than 100 football fields stands between non-losing and winning. The endless buckets of sweat and the occasional splatter of blood were never shed for non-losing seasons. Those were for wins. The early morning runs and the sacrifice of a “normal college experience” wasn’t for mediocrity, they were for greatness. This unrest is what fueled us during the program’s most important offseason. We were stacked with offensive weapons and defensive playmakers. Emerging leaders like Eddie Gadson pushed the team to improve during 5:30 a.m. workouts and player-led practices throughout the spring. Our attitude blurred between cocky and confident. But that all changed when tragedy struck a few short weeks before the season was slated to begin. Our worlds were shocked and a wound was delivered to us like we had never experienced. As pride morphed to humility, our confidence gave way to something bigger: the ability to believe. The ability to believe in each other. The ability to believe that a football team can provide healing. The ability to believe, against all odds, that the last place team in the conference could have a chance to play for a championship. The ability to believe in something bigger than ourselves. This is the story of the 2005 CSU Bucs. This is how we learned to believe.
